How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Fort Superhighway?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Fort Superhighway 1 Bedroom Apartments | $960 | $875 | $1,300 |
| Fort Superhighway 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,111 | $900 | $1,400 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Fort Superhighway
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Fort Superhighway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Fort Superhighway ranges from $875 to $1,300 with an average monthly rent of $960.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Fort Superhighway c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Fort Superhighway range from $900 to $1,400.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,111.
